TO GET THE RIPPLES
Take the cookies out 2 to 3 minutes before they are fulling done baking. With both hands (with oven mitts on) beat the pan against the counter a few times. Don’t be too gentle, have fun with it. You will see with your eyes the ripples begin to form. Place back in oven to finish baking.
Set on cooling rack when complete.

Makes: 4-6 servings Time: 25 mins in oven (oven time can vary)
What You Need:
1 lb to 1 1/2 lbs of thin chicken breasts cut into 1/4 inch strips
1 lb of baby bell peppers cut in half and seeded
1 large yellow onion sliced
2 Tablespoons of Olive Oil
1 Tablespoon of Chili Powder
2 teaspoons of salt
1 teaspoon of pepper
1 teaspoon of paprika
1 teaspoon of garlic powder
1 large lime
8 to 10 warmed tortillas
Steps:
1. In a small bowl mix together the chili powder, salt, pepper, paprika, and garlic powder.
2. Line a sheet pan with foil. Arrange baby bell peppers on the sheet pan. Drizzle a tablespoon of olive oil onto the peppers and apply half of the seasoning from the bowl to the peppers.
3. Place the sheet of peppers under the broiler for about 15 to 20 mins until peppers begin to blacken a little and char. (If your broiler has a setting for low or high, set it to high)
4. In a medium bowl combine the chicken strips, tablespoon of olive oil, and the rest of the seasoning.
5. Pull out sheet pan and place chicken strips onto the peppers. Broil for an additional 5 minutes or until chicken is cooked through.
6. Squeeze lime over entire sheet of peppers and chicken.
Serve with warmed tortillas, sour cream, cheese, guacamole, or salsa! So easy and delish!
Enjoy!
Note: This is all made with the broiler setting on your oven. You are NOT baking these. Broilers can be tricky, it’s okay to keep opening your oven to check with the peppers. With the chicken though, 5 mins is the magic number! Don’t open the oven!

Step 1: Fill a small to medium size pot of water, then, place desired amount of eggs into water. Turn stove top to medium high (to about a 7 or 8 on stove)
Step 2: When water comes to a rolling boil, turn heat down to medium (About a 5 or 4). You want to keep the rolling boil going but you don’t want it to be an aggressive boil. Set timer for 18 minutes.
Step 3: Once the timer goes off remove pot from stove immediately and place eggs into an ice bath (a bowl of water with ice). Let sit for about 5 to 10 minutes.

Blueberry Muffins With Oatmeal Streusel Topping
Oven: 400 Makes: 12 muffins Bake: 15-18 mins oven time varies
Insert toothpick and when it comes out clean then it’s complete
What You Need For Muffins:
1 3/4 cups of flour
1 1/4 cup of sugar
2 teaspoons baking powder
1 beaten egg
1/4 teaspoon salt
3/4 cup of milk
1/4 cup of vegetable oil
3/4 cup fresh blueberries
What You Need For Oatmeal Streusel Topping:
3 tablespoons of brown sugar
1/4 teaspoon of cinnamon
A dash of nutmeg (optional)
2 tablespoons of butter
3-5 tablespoons of rolled oats (if you don’t want to use oats you can use flour)
Steps For Muffins:
1. Combine flour, sugar, salt, and baking powder in large mixing bowl. In another small mixing bowl combine beaten egg, milk, and oil.
2. Make a well in the middle of the flour mixture and then add egg mixture. Mix until completely combined. Then add fresh blueberries to mixture.
3. Spoon batter into muffin tins, then sprinkle streusel topping on muffins. Bake at 400 for 15 to 18 mins.
Serve with softened butter. Absolutely delish.
Steps For Oatmeal Streusel Topping:
Combine the oatmeal, brown sugar, cinnamon and nutmeg in a small bowl. Add butter until the mixture becomes crumbly. Sprinkle onto muffins before baking.
